Early Life

Mariann Aalda was born on July 5, 1948 in Chicago, Illinois. Raised in the bustling city, she developed a love for performing arts at a young age. Aalda's passion for theater led her to pursue a career in professional theater, prompting her move to New York City in search of opportunities in the entertainment industry.

Career Beginnings

Aalda made her on-screen debut in 1978 with a background role in the movie adaptation of The Wiz. This experience fueled her desire to continue acting and she began to build her resume with various television and film projects.

Television Success

One of Aalda's most notable roles was as a part of the ensemble cast of CBS's The Royal Family. The sitcom gained popularity and allowed Aalda to showcase her talent to a wider audience. She also appeared in ABC's Edge of Night and NBC's Sunset Beach, further solidifying her presence in the television industry.

Film Ventures

While primarily known for her television work, Aalda also dabbled in film. She landed small roles in movies such as Class Act and Pretty Woman, showcasing her versatility as an actress.

Other Endeavors

Aside from her acting career, Aalda also delved into hosting with a USA Network program called Designs for Living. This allowed her to explore a different aspect of the entertainment industry and expand her skill set.
